Get your website built up! Present an attractive, user friendly website that has all the resources available and in plain site. This doesn’t mean one page with everything crammed onto it. Use web space correctly and effectively.

Keep your website updated! Make sure to have all of the most popular social media links available for easy sharing! Keep an accurate information, news, maps, deals, ect..

DO! ● News - keep people updated on what is going on with Habitat ReStores, keep interest! ● Share partnerships! We want to give our partners recognition.

● Find new donors! Post about how and where people can give to the cause! If people are reminded often enough and shown what it means to support the mission and vision of Habitat for Humanity they will be more likely to donate themselves. ● Bring in volunteers. This is pretty self-explanatory. People want to do good deeds. Spreading the word about volunteer activities will get more volunteers in. Simple as that.

● DIY projects! DIY is trending and as a green non-profit selling gently used recycled furniture and appliances we could really be getting a lot of attention from DIYers looking to do their next project in an affordable way. We should be posting projects from DIY projects consistently. People don't want to see pictures of things in their before stages without a little inspiration for what can be done with these wonderful recycled goods. So, I propose we minimize the use of pictures of the ReStores themselves and focus more on these great projects. Have crafters post their completed ReStore projects! Get them involved too!

● Sales in the ReStores? Well, post it to Facebook and make sure people mention they saw us on Facebook! Maybe even ask them to post pictures of their finds from the ReStores and the projects they are going to be used in? ● Cross media post! Something trending on Twitter? Share that on Facebook! ● YouTube on Facebook could be fantastic! For the people interested in getting the message, how to help, where to help, and feel good vibes all at one time - a video is probably the best way to get them into the ReStores.

● Share our non-profit mission and vision statements-often! Let people know what the purpose is behind Habitat for Humanity and the importance of the ReStores to that mission! ● Stress that we are a GREEN - Recycle/upcycle organization!

Don’t! ● Use for personal political agenda! We are non-partisan! We keep the name of our organization out of politics. That is not a part of our mission or mission vision. ● Use a gossip column. This is a non-profit organization, not a personal page. ● Forget to keep current and interesting! If you aren't updating often enough or giving people enough to keep interest we are going to lose potential volunteers, customers, and donors.

DO! ● News ● Partnerships ● Donation options ● Volunteer opportunities ● DIY projects completed by ReStore customers (always # as #DIYReStore) ● Sales ● Cross media posts ● Mission and Mission Vision ● Green

Don't ● Forget to use the hashtag! (#) ● Forget to tweet often! ● Forget to post DIY projects tagged #DIYReStore ● Get political!
